Podcast: Let’s Keep Believing

5th May 2025

It was an all-round run of discouraging results for Fulham this weekend as the race for a Conference League continues to rage on. Fulham lost 1-0 to an impressive Aston Villa side away at Villa Park which possibly was always a result to be expected but all the same, disappointing. 

George is joined by Ben Jarman, host of the Fulhamerica podcast, and Joe Gunning, making his Fulhamish debut. In part one, they look at Silva’s changes to the starting XI against Villa, consider the substitutions and descent to ten men, and reflect on a run of poor performances from Fulham.  

In part two, they answer some of your listener questions. Do Fulham need another year to grow before they are ready for Europe? Should Adama be starting rather than coming on as a sub? How important does Brentford away now look?
